Tax Breakdown
| Item | Annual | Monthly |
|---|---|---|
| Gross Income | $57,214.00 | $4,767.83 |
| Federal Income Tax | -$4,827.18 | -$402.27 |
| Montana State Tax | -$3,375.63 | -$281.30 |
| Social Security (6.2%) | -$3,547.27 | -$295.61 |
| Medicare (1.45%) | -$829.60 | -$69.13 |
| Take-Home Pay | $44,634.32 | $3,719.53 |

Tax Saving Tips for Helena Residents
- Montana's income tax rate of 5.9% is above average. Maximize pre-tax retirement contributions (401k up to $23,500, IRA up to $7,000) to reduce both federal and state taxable income.
- Property tax in Helena (0.85%) is below the national average of 1.1%. This makes homeownership more affordable here relative to property tax burden.
- Helena has no sales tax, which can save thousands annually on everyday purchases and large-ticket items like electronics, furniture, and vehicles.
- Use a Health Savings Account (HSA) if eligible. Contributions are tax-deductible ($4,400 individual, $8,750 family), growth is tax-free, and withdrawals for medical expenses are tax-free.

How much is property tax in Helena?
The effective property tax rate in Helena is 0.85%. On the median home price of $320,000, this equals approximately $2,720 per year or $227 per month. This is below the national average of 1.1%.
What is the sales tax rate in Helena?
Helena has no sales tax. Montana is one of the few states that does not impose a state or local sales tax.

Are there any local taxes in Helena?
Helena does not impose a separate local or city income tax. Residents pay the state income tax of 5.9%, federal income tax, and FICA (Social Security and Medicare). State capital; no sales tax
